This report provides key results of a three-year experimental and theoretical research and development effort performed under the auspices of the U.S. Nuclear Regulatory Commission. The goal of the R&D was to establish the validity of online calibration monitoring of process instrumentation channels in nuclear power plants. The author concludes that the normal outputs of instrument channels in nuclear plants can be monitored over a fuel cycle while the plant is operating and during startup and shutdown periods to verify the calibration of the instruments, thereby improving plant efficiency and safety, eliminating unnecessary calibrations, and reducing operations and maintenance costs.

The nuclear industry and the U.S. Nuclear Regulatory Commission (USNRC) have been working for several years on the development of an adequate process to guide the replacement of aging analog monitoring and control instrumentation in nuclear power plants with modern digital instrumentation without introducing off-setting safety problems. This book identifies criteria for the USNRC's review and acceptance of digital applications in nuclear power plants. It focuses on eight areas: software quality assurance, common-mode software failure potential, systems aspects of digital instrumentation and control technology, human factors and human-machine interfaces, safety and reliability assessment methods, dedication of commercial off-the-shelf hardware and software, the case-by-case licensing process, and the adequacy of technical infrastructure.

Safety, reliability, and productivity in the nuclear industry result from a systematic consideration of human performance. A plant or other facility consists of both the engineered system and the human users of that system. It is therefore crucial that engineering activities consider the humans who will be interacting with those systems. Engineering design, specifically instrumentation and control (I&C) design, can influence human performance by driving how plant personnel carry out work and respond to events within a nuclear power plant. As a result, human–system interfaces (HSIs) for plant operators as well as the maintenance and testing of the I&C system cannot be designed by isolated disciplines. The focus of this publication is to integrate knowledge from the disciplines of human factors engineering (HFE) and I&C to emphasize an interdisciplinary approach for the design of better HSIs and consequently improved human performance in nuclear power plants. This is accomplished by practical explanations of the HFE processes and corresponding outputs that inform the I&C development. More specifically, the publication addresses issues in the design process where collaboration between HFE, I&C and other important disciplines and stakeholders is paramount and identifies key tools and tasks for exchanging inputs and outputs between different design disciplines, particularly I&C and HFE. IAEA work in the area of research reactor operation and maintenance is aimed at enhancing the capabilities of Member States to utilize good engineering and management practices to improve research reactor reliability and availability. In particular, the IAEA supports activities addressing ageing management of research reactor instrumentation and control (I&C) systems. The purpose of this publication is to provide engineering guidance on the design, and operational aspects of digital I&C systems for the refurbishment of existing facilities and for new research reactors. Key areas addressed include codes and standards applicability, licensing issues, dealing with the change in human-system interface from analogue to digital technology, software verification and validation activities, periodic testing and inspection, and configuration management. The publication contains technical descriptions and summaries of available digital systems that have been utilized in both new research reactor designs, and in the upgrading of older analogue safety and control systems.
